Death count rises to 10 over weekend Monday, Wyandot County Public Health reported a total of 160 coronavirus cases in the county, including 142 lab-confirmed cases, 10 probable cases and eight additional probable cases based on positive antibody tests for Wyandot County. Of the reported individuals, one is currently hospitalized. There have been 10 deaths and 118 recoveries. Thirty-two cases are considered active. Do not rely on … Read More
